First of all before u trade someone check their rooms, and if they dont have any rooms and they have really good furniture then they are most likley scammers, and if they do have rooms but no furni inside of them and they have good furni that they wanna trade u then he or she is probably a scammer. And if he wants to trade in his or her room he or she is probably a scammer so just trade in a public room. And if the offer is too good to be true it probably is so dont take it unless u are positive the person is not a scammer.ok so if u are trading someone and u accept and he takes too long to accept press cancle and say u did taht on accident, and if he leaves the room or says brb i hve to go somewhere then that means he makes fakes.
and keep all ur rares and supers on a clone account cause right a lot of people are getting hacked so protect ur furni by doing this
